Crawford & Co (CRD.A) USD1 A

Sell:$10.61Buy:$10.67$0.11 (1.05%)

Prices delayed by at least 15 minutes
Sell:$10.61
Buy:$10.67
Change:$0.11 (1.05%)
Prices delayed by at least 15 minutes
Sell:$10.61
Buy:$10.67
Change:$0.11 (1.05%)
Prices delayed by at least 15 minutes